Description

Aphrodite Assisted Living in Anchorage, AK is a board and care home that offers a comfortable and enriching environment for seniors. Our community features a dining room where residents can enjoy delicious meals prepared by our staff. The fully furnished rooms create a cozy atmosphere, and our garden provides a serene outdoor space for relaxation and fresh air.

At Aphrodite Assisted Living, we strive to make life easier for our residents by offering housekeeping services and move-in coordination. Our community is equipped with telephone and Wi-Fi/high-speed internet access, allowing residents to stay connected with loved ones.

We understand the importance of providing excellent care services, which is why our dedicated staff is available to assist with activities of daily living, including bathing, dressing, and transfers. We also coordinate with health care providers to ensure that our residents receive the necessary medical attention they need. For individuals with diabetes or special dietary restrictions, we offer diabetes diets and special meal preparation.

Transportation arrangements are provided for medical purposes as well as for doctors' appointments. Residents can conveniently access nearby cafes, pharmacies, physicians' offices, restaurants, places of worship, and hospitals.

In addition to providing essential care services, Aphrodite Assisted Living encourages an active lifestyle through scheduled daily activities. Whether it's engaging in social events or pursuing personal hobbies, there are plenty of opportunities for residents to stay active and engaged within our community.

Overall, Aphrodite Assisted Living offers a warm and supportive environment where seniors can live comfortably while receiving the assistance they need.
